  • TIPS TO PROTECT YOURSELF FROM OR CODE SCAMS

    To safeguard yourself from QR code scams, consider these tips:

    Scan with Caution: Only scan QR codes from trusted sources. Be wary of codes found in public places or received via unsolicited emails or messages.

    Verify the Source: Before scanning a QR code, verify the source and legitimacy of the code. Check for any signs of tampering or alterations.

    Inspect the URL: After scanning a QR code, inspect the URL it redirects to. Ensure it matches the expected destination and doesn't lead to a suspicious or phishing website.

    Use a Secure QR Code Scanner: Use a reputable QR code scanner app from a trusted source. Some scanners offer additional security features, such as URL preview and blocking malicious codes.

    Avoid Personal Information: Refrain from scanning QR codes that request sensitive information, such as passwords, credit card details, or personal identification.

    Stay Updated: Keep your QR code scanner app and device software up-to-date to mitigate vulnerabilities and security risks.

    Be Skeptical of Promotions: Exercise caution when scanning QR codes offering discounts, promotions, or prizes. Verify the legitimacy of the offer through official channels before proceeding.

    By following these precautions, you can reduce the risk of falling victim to QR code scams and protect your personal information and devices.

  • Choosing between hashtag#SOC 2 and hashtag#ISO27001 for your organization's information security needs? Here's a quick breakdown:

    𝐏𝐮đĢ𝐩𝐨đŦ𝐞:
    𝐒𝐎𝐂 𝟐: Focuses on securing client data comprehensively.
    𝐈𝐒𝐎 𝟐𝟕𝟎𝟎𝟏: Establishes an Information Security Management System (ISMS) for safeguarding information assets.

    𝐀𝐮𝐝đĸ𝐞𝐧𝐜𝐞:
    𝐒𝐎𝐂 𝟐: Especially relevant for clients in technology and cloud services.
    𝐈𝐒𝐎 𝟐𝟕𝟎𝟎𝟏: Suitable for any organization prioritizing information asset security.

    𝐅đĢ𝐚đĻ𝐞𝐰𝐨đĢ𝐤:
    𝐒𝐎𝐂 𝟐: AICPA’s Trust Services Criteria.
    𝐈𝐒𝐎 𝟐𝟕𝟎𝟎𝟏: Part of the ISO 27000 family, detailing ISMS requirements.

    𝐆𝐞𝐨𝐠đĢ𝐚𝐩𝐡đĸ𝐜𝐚đĨ 𝐑𝐞𝐜𝐨𝐠𝐧đĸ𝐭đĸ𝐨𝐧:
    𝐒𝐎𝐂 𝟐: Primarily U.S. but gaining global recognition.
    𝐈𝐒𝐎 𝟐𝟕𝟎𝟎𝟏: Globally recognized and accepted.

    𝐂𝐞đĢ𝐭đĸ𝐟đĸ𝐜𝐚𝐭đĸ𝐨𝐧:
    𝐒𝐎𝐂 𝟐: Issues SOC 2 report but no formal certification.
    𝐈𝐒𝐎 𝟐𝟕𝟎𝟎𝟏: Can be formally certified, demonstrating compliance to third parties.

    Both offer different approaches and benefits, so choose wisely based on your organization's needs and objectives.

  • What is a Password Manager?

    A password manager is a software application that helps users store, organize, and manage their passwords securely. Instead of trying to remember multiple complex passwords for different accounts, a password manager allows you to store all your passwords in one encrypted database. This database is protected by a master password, which is the only password you need to remember.

  • Why Do Organizations Need Ethical Hacking?

    Ethical hacking, also known as penetration testing or white-hat hacking, involves authorized professionals using their skills to identify vulnerabilities in an organization's systems, networks, and applications. Unlike malicious hackers, ethical hackers work with the consent of the organization to uncover weaknesses that could be exploited by cyber attackers.
